Haryana, Lok Sabha election 1996
10 constituencies in Haryana, 68.25% turnout.
Party performance
Ordered by seats won in Haryana
| Party | Won | +/− | Contested | Votes | Share | Share +/− |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| BJPBharatiya Janata Party | 4 | +4 | 6 | 15,02,723 | 19.74% | +9.57 |
| HVPHaryana Vikas Party | 3 | +2 | 4 | 11,56,322 | 15.19% | +9.85 |
| INCIndian National Congress | 2 | -7 | 10 | 17,23,087 | 22.64% | -14.58 |
| INDIndependent | 1 | +1 | 210 | 7,80,122 | 10.25% | +4.77 |
| SAPSAP | 0 | 0 | 10 | 14,47,340 | 19.01% | — |
| BSPBahujan Samaj Party | 0 | 0 | 6 | 5,01,958 | 6.59% | +4.80 |
| AIICTAIICT | 0 | 0 | 8 | 1,71,005 | 2.25% | — |
| JDJanata Dal | 0 | 0 | 8 | 1,16,845 | 1.54% | -10.95 |
| SPSamajwadi Party | 0 | 0 | 3 | 86,172 | 1.13% | — |
| CPICommunist Party of India | 0 | 0 | 1 | 27,573 | 0.36% | — |
| JPJP | 0 | 0 | 6 | 15,960 | 0.21% | -25.20 |
| JPSJustice Party | 0 | 0 | 1 | 15,112 | 0.20% | — |
| ABJSABJS | 0 | 0 | 1 | 14,292 | 0.19% | — |
| JSTPJSTP | 0 | 0 | 2 | 10,134 | 0.13% | — |
| JHMJHM | 0 | 0 | 2 | 9,404 | 0.12% | — |
| SHSShiv Sena | 0 | 0 | 4 | 9,223 | 0.12% | — |
| ARSARS | 0 | 0 | 1 | 6,367 | 0.08% | — |
| RKPRKP | 0 | 0 | 1 | 3,635 | 0.05% | — |
| ICSIndian Congress (Socialist) | 0 | 0 | 2 | 3,418 | 0.04% | — |
| FBLAll India Forward Bloc | 0 | 0 | 2 | 2,432 | 0.03% | +0.02 |
| RPIRPI | 0 | 0 | 1 | 2,332 | 0.03% | — |
| ABDUPABDUP | 0 | 0 | 1 | 1,996 | 0.03% | — |
| BLPBharatiya Lokvikas Party | 0 | 0 | 1 | 1,900 | 0.02% | — |
| PPNMSPPNMS | 0 | 0 | 1 | 889 | 0.01% | — |
| BKDJBKDJ | 0 | 0 | 1 | 882 | 0.01% | — |
| RKDRKD | 0 | 0 | 1 | 520 | 0.01% | -0.01 |

Constituency results
All 10 seats, alphabetical · showing 1–10 of 10
| Constituency | Winner | Runner-up | Margin | Turnout |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| AMBALA | BJPSURAJ BHAN | INCSHER SINGH | 87,14710.92% | 72.6% |
| BHIWANI | HVPSURENDER SINGH | INCJANGBIR SINGH | 2,25,18330.84% | 68.9% |
| FARIDABAD | BJPRAM CHANDER | INCAVTAR SINGH BHADANA | 61,5167.53% | 58.6% |
| HISSAR | HVPJAI PARKASH S/O HARIKESH | SAPGAURI SHANKER | 1,74,65224.12% | 70.3% |
| KARNAL | BJPISHWAR DAYAL SWAMI | INCCHIRANJI LAL SHARMA | 1,91,86523.96% | 69.7% |
| KURUKSHETRA | HVPOM PARKASH JINDAL | SAPKALASHO DEVI | 51,7776.46% | 72.8% |
| MAHENDRAGARH | BJPRAM SINGH | INCRAO BIRENDER SINGH | 48,0356.06% | 64.0% |
| ROHTAK | INCBHUPENDER | SAPDEVI LAL | 2,6640.43% | 65.8% |
| SIRSA | INCSELJA | SAPSUSHIL KUMAR | 15,1471.84% | 76.7% |
| SONEPAT | INDARVIND KUMAR | SAPRIJAQ RAM | 49,5407.08% | 66.1% |
Vote share and swing on this page are the party’s share of valid votes in Haryana alone — a different number from its national or all-state figures, and never mixed with them.

Who won the Haryana, Lok Sabha election 1996?
Bharatiya Janata Party won 4 of 10 seats in Haryana, short of a majority on its own.
What was the voter turnout in the Haryana, Lok Sabha election 1996?
Turnout was 68.25% — 76.1 lakh of 1.12 cr registered electors voted.
How many Lok Sabha seats does Haryana have?
Haryana has 10 Lok Sabha seats.
